As many of you would know, the Islamic Awareness Week (IAW) has come to an end. The purpose of this week was to raise awareness about Islam, and to convey the message of Allah to the people.
By the grace of Allah, this was one of the best Awareness Weeks we have ever held! Throughout the week, we had hundreds of people coming to the many events we held, and many were very interested to learn about Islam, and find out more about Muslims. We gave out hundreds of Islamic materials during the week, including books, CD's, DVD's, and Pamphlets. We ask Allah to make these materials beneficial, and to guide all those who attended - Ameen.
LTUIS would like to say a HUGE thank you to all those who helped make this year's Islamic Awareness Week the great success it was! Without the help of Allah, and then your help, the week would not have been as successful as it was. We ask Allah The Almighty to reward everyone who participated, helped out, or donated, with the highest levels of Paradise!
This thread is to receive feedback on the week as a whole. Do you think it was run well? Is there anything in particular that you really enjoyed? Are there any things you would like to see happen for next year's IAW? Are there any experiences you had throughout the week you would like to share?
Please let us know all of your feedback and experiences, so we can take them into account for next time!

Ok, here's my feed-back...
Monday: I had to leave early for class, so im not 100% sure on how things went in the end, so i'll be referring to what happened when I was there. I think we spent too much time on preparing food/serving, instead of giving da'wah. The showbags were easy to give out, but we should have had taken the time to get bro/sis to have a chat about Islam to the non-Muslims whilst they were eating. I'm not too sure on how it went on the brothers side, but maybe we should have had a da'wah table down that end aswell or a brother *permanently* on the table where some sisters were aswell.
Tuesday: I enjoyed this day very much so, al-hamdulillaah. The only problems that we would need to fix for next year would be:
- Make sure there are 2 laptops on the bro and sis side, for the screenings. My laptop snapped at me last minute and a sister (may Allah preserve her) went home and brang her laptop.
- Also, I felt that the projector idea wasn't that effective as sometimes it got too loud and no one seemed to be listening.
- We lacked volunteers on this day. Al-hamdulillaah, I had to miss a v. Important class b/c we didn't have much people who would talk to/welcome the non-Muslims.
Wednesday: I think the brothers were on the da’wah table most of the time, so i’m not too sure how that went. But we should have had some volunteers standing around the mini oval ground and talking to non-Muslims that were standing around or sitting there.
Also, even though the food was delish and ran out fast, wal-hamdulillaah, we didn’t have enough savoury food. I think this was b/c of the whole food inspection issue and the bro/sis that were cooking wanted to be on the safe side.
Thursday: If the goal of this day was to have non-Muslims interact with us via sport, then it would have been a success for the brothers and a failure for the sisters – though we did have some good fun.
Maybe the sisters can have a different type of event on that day to the brothers. Like have a traditional clothing/mini picnic in the mosque with some non-Muslims. Or a screening?
Friday: Sh. Abu Adnan (hafidhahullah) made this night for me. I’m not too sure if there was much non-Muslims there, but masha Allah we had lots of bro/sis from outside the university. So, advertising must have worked well, al-hamdulillaah. Also, we’ve had some Muslims contact us about attending our events/future events, as they were impressed, masha Allah.
In regards to having non-Muslims present on this night, maybe next year we can work on getting those who come to our events to attend most of our events and especially our lecture night.
and that's my feedback...
Was-Salam
